Ingredients:

  • 4 medium zucchini (approx. 1.5 lbs)
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 lb 90% lean ground beef
  • 1 medium yellow onion, finely di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up frozen corn, thawed
  • 1 cup low-carb salsa
  • 1 tbsp chili powder
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ded Monterey Jack cheese

Instructions:

  1. Heat the oven. Set it to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Prep the zucchini. Slice each zucchini in half lengthwise. Use a spoon to scoop out the center flesh, leaving a 1/4 inch wall. Note: Save the scooped out flesh for a stir fry later.
  3. Pre roast the shells. Place zucchini boats on a baking sheet, drizzle with olive oil, and sprinkle with salt. Roast 5-7 minutes until they look slightly softened.
  4. Brown the beef. Heat a large skillet over medium high heat. Add ground beef and cook until browned and crumbly. Drain the fat, but leave about 1 tablespoon in the pan.
  5. Sauté vegetables. Stir in the diced onion and red bell pepper. Cook 4-5 minutes until the onion is translucent.
  6. Toast the spices. Add minced garlic, chili powder, cumin, and smoked paprika. Stir for 60 seconds until the aroma fills the kitchen.
  7. Simmer the filling. Fold in the black beans, corn, and salsa. Simmer 3-5 minutes until the mixture is thick and glossy.
  8. Stuff the boats. Spoon the beef filling generously into the pre roasted zucchini boats.
  9. Add cheese. Top each boat with shredded Monterey Jack cheese.
  10. Final bake. Bake 10 minutes until the cheese is bubbling and browned.
  11. Garnish and serve. Top with fresh chopped cilantro and optional avocado or sour cream.
